Revelations

Darren Donohue

Genre: One Act, Absurd

Cast size: 3

Duration: 60 mins approx

Darren Donohue | Absurd | One Act | 3m

Short synopsis

The aftermath of a global pandemic. A city is in ashes. A hide-out in the deserted tenements. An old man commits an atrocity. A young man discovers it. Age and treachery is pitted against youth and skill. This lyrical play follows the reminiscences of a chair-bound old man who is attended by another old man, his keeper. We realise that all is not as it appears in this world, and that something dreadful is happening outside.

A world in ashes. A hide-out in the deserted tenements. An old man commits an atrocity. A young man discovers it. Age and treachery are pitted against youth and skill.

‘Revelations’ opens with Man 1, a chair-bound old man reminiscing about his youth.  He carefully refines the words he uses to describe his memories, as though striving to recapture the essence of past experience. These recollections include his first memory, his first love, and a moment of mutual compassion/connection with a stranger.  However, he struggles to keep darker memories that haunt him at bay.  The pain in his knee grows worse, he rings a bell, and Man 2 enters.  Man 2 appears to care for Man 1, stretching out his knee and checking he is comfortable.  However, Man 1 refuses to speak to Man 2, and there is an uneasy (often comic) tension between them.  It appears Man 2 is also documenting his memories/fantasies, writing them down in a book, and these he reads to Man 1, much to Man 1’s annoyance.  Man 2 eventually exits, and Man 1 eagerly returns to his recollections.  Unfortunately, darker experiences from Man 1’s past return to torment him.

In scene 2, we discover that something terrifying is happening in the outside world. And, the men live in constant danger of being discovered.  We also learn how Man 1 and Man 2 met and begin to understand the complex relationship that exists between them.

In scene 3, the world they managed to shut out breaks in on them in the form of Man 3.  Secrets from the past are uncovered and the true terror that awaits them is revealed. Fatal choices are made, and a treacherous plot is hatched, as they come to terms with their predicament and desperately cling to survival.

With wit and lyricism, ‘Revelations’ explores the treads that keep us tethered to hope and salvation when everything else is stripped away.

(3m)

  • Man 1 - late 50s/early 60s, wheelchair bound, dressed in an old, ragged suit and dirty shirt
  • Man 2 - late 50s/early 60s, should wear glasses when reading and an impression of false teeth, wears old suit trousers and a work man’s shirt
  • Man 3 - 20, his clothes were once fine but, over the course of time, they have disintegrated

Frequently asked questions

Can we try before we buy?

Of course! All our plays and pantomimes have a free Preview Script available for download as an A4 pdf file that contains 60-75% of the full script. If you like what you read then you can buy an inexpensive e-script of the entire play (typically less than half the cost of a traditional printed script) which is licensed to you for your personal use. Purchasing a script copying licence allows you to make just enough copies to support rehearsals and performances.

All our musicals are included in our perusal service. Through this, representatives of producing organisations can request a USB Stick of perusal material  which comprise the script/libretto and piano/vocal score as PDF files; a Cast (or Studio) Recording as MP3 files and (where available) an MP4 file video of either the premiere production or of a subsequent production.

Some titles have the facility to read the entire script online on our website.

Do we need a Licence To Perform?

The simple answer is, yes.

Under the international laws of copyright, you must be in possession of a valid, unexpired licence before performing any piece of theatre unless the owner or managers of the copyright has waived their rights.

Why do you insist on providing a formal royalties quotation?

When you request a quotation, it is logged in our system, it forms part of an orderly queue and protects your place in that queue should multiple licensing requests occur for the same show.
